CBL International Facilitates Xiaomo Port's First LNG Bunkering for BYD in Shenzhen

CBL International Limited facilitated Xiaomo Port's inaugural LNG bunkering operation for BYD in Shenzhen, collaborating with CNOOC. This strategic move diversifies CBL's revenue into sustainable fuel offerings and supports BYD's maritime decarbonization efforts. The initiative highlights LNG as a key marine clean energy source, aligning with global efforts to reduce greenhouse gas emissions and lower fuel costs.

CBL International Limited (Nasdaq: BANL) reported unaudited 1H 2026 results for six months ended June 30, 2026

CBL International Limited (Nasdaq: BANL) reported unaudited 1H 2026 results for six months ended June 30, 2026. Revenue rose 49.2% to $395.59M, gross profit increased 140.5% to $6.53M, and net income was about $1.50M versus a $992k loss in 1H 2025. The company declared a $0.10 special cash dividend per share and announced a 1-for-13 reverse split to regain Nasdaq bid-price compliance.

M-tron Secures $4.5 Mln Order For US Air Defense Program

M-tron Industries (MPTI) said it won a $4.5 million order from a U.S. defense prime contractor for a major air defense program. The two-year contract covers rugged RF filters, with annual volumes rising 50% versus prior 12-month orders. Work runs in Orlando through 2028. Shares were down 0.68% at $87.88.
